## Onboarding: Invoicer-PDF Service

Quick context for the weekly sync: the Fernwick invoice renderer converts billing payloads into branded PDFs. It pulls templates from the Larkspool asset store, stamps line items, and writes output to the archive bucket. Rendering jobs are idempotent, so retries are safe. Local dev runs fine against the staging endpoint; just seed a sample payload from the fixtures folder. To authenticate against the staging render API, use the key below.

service key, tadup-tahog: zpat7_wB1tnEL

Quarterly Planning Note — Pricing, Ridgeway Line

Quick one for the board: the Ridgeway line at Fennett Labs is still priced below the Ostram comparison set. We're proposing a six percent uplift on the top two SKUs and holding the entry model flat. Channel partners have been sounded out informally. Here's the confidential thinking behind the move.

board note of fahif-hahop: The steering committee signed off on a budget of $63.9 million for Project Ulaath. The renewal with Ralvanox Systems closes at $63.0 million a year, 58 percent below the last contract.

**Key Ceremony Checklist — Item 7 (Quickfind Index)**

Hey, welcome aboard! Before we rotate the signing keys for Pellwick's search cluster, double-check the Quickfind autocomplete index. It's been rebuilding slowly lately (sometimes 40+ minutes), so kick off the rebuild early and don't panic if it crawls. Once it reports green, confirm the ceremony witness (usually Dara from platform) has signed the attendance sheet. When both are done, retrieve the sealed envelope from the ops cabinet. The recovery passphrase you'll need is printed below.

unlock words, tawif-tahop: oliys-ulawyn-tamdor-lamys-casox-jormir-fraius-kasath-ulador-ulamir-holir-sorys-holeth

Action item from the Brindlewick kiosk outage: the watchdog on the Ordertide app was way too trigger-happy, restarting the UI mid-transaction whenever the scanner lagged. Marisol's fix loosens the restart thresholds and adds a grace window after boot. Please verify the new constants land in the 4.2 release build. The tuned values are as follows.

limits module of yadug-yagap:
RATE_LIMITS = {
    "quenix": 5,
    "druwyn": 2,
}